What are the Three Basic Elements of Stage Lighting?
Understanding the three basic elements of stage lighting—intensity, color, and distribution—is fundamental for any lighting professional. This article clarifies these core concepts, helping you create effective and impactful stage lighting designs. Mastering these elements is key to achieving the desired mood and visual storytelling in your productions.
Intensity: Controlling Brightness
Intensity refers to the brightness of the light. This is controlled primarily by the lighting instrument itself (dimmer packs, for example) and modified with tools like gels, diffusers, and barn doors. Precise intensity control is crucial for highlighting key actors, creating dramatic shadows, or establishing a specific atmosphere. Consider the function of each light source in relation to the overall scene. Overly bright lights can wash out detail, while insufficient intensity can leave areas dark and unclear.
Color: Shaping the Mood
Color is a powerful tool in stage lighting, used to evoke emotions and enhance the narrative. This is achieved through the use of color filters (gels) placed in front of lighting instruments. The color temperature of a light source (measured in Kelvin) also influences the overall feel; warmer colors (lower Kelvin) create intimacy, while cooler colors (higher Kelvin) can convey coldness or distance. Careful color selection contributes significantly to the aesthetic success of your production.
Distribution: Directing the Light
Distribution refers to how the light is spread across the stage. This is determined by the type of lighting instrument used, the angle of the fixture, and the use of shaping accessories like barn doors, gobos, and lenses. Spotlights provide a concentrated beam, ideal for highlighting specific actors or objects. Floodlights create a wider, more diffused light, useful for illuminating larger areas. Understanding light distribution allows for precise control over the light's impact on the scene, leading to a more polished and professional result.
